Compare Lemoore to West Puente Valley
This post compares Lemoore, California to West Puente Valley,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.
Dimension | Lemoore (city) | West Puente Valley (CDP) |
---|---|---|
Population | 25,525 | 23,487 |
Income (median) | $39,121 | $35,108 |
Home Value (median) | $199,200 | $374,900 |
White | 58% | 39% |
Black | 5% | 3% |
Asian | 7% | 9% |
With Kids | 46% | 45% |
Age (median) | 28 | 36 |
Rentals | 48% | 20% |
